As the owner of a property in the Cook County Class 9 Program, you are required to file an annual affidavit with the Cook County Assessor’s Office. Please complete the affidavit and include all Permanent Index Numbers participating in the program.
The deadline for returning the affidavit is August 30, 2023.*
Failure to file a completed affidavit, with the correct information by the required deadline, may result in the removal of the property from the Class 9 program.

I, as the owner or agent of the subject property, swear that the following is true and correct:

  1. The subject property is in compliance with local building codes, or if there are no local building codes, Housing Quality Standards, as determined by the United States Department of Housing and Urban Development. If the property was found not to be in compliance with applicable building, safety and health codes since the property was admitted into the program, I have attached written evidence that any violations have been cured and the relevant government agency has confirmed that the building is now in compliance with the applicable building, safety and health codes.
  2. Attached is a complete Class 9 Rental Information/Tenant Household Income Report Form which identifies the affordable units in the residential real property and includes household income information. I attest that the affordable units are comparable to the market rate units in terms of unit type, number of bedrooms per unit, quality of exterior appearance, energy efficiency, and overall quality of construction.

    Please note: Only Word (.doc, .docx), PDF (.pdf) or Excel (.xls, .xlsx) documents will be accepted.

  3. I have obtained Class 9 Rental Information/Tenant Household Income Report Forms for each designated Class 9 unit and such forms will be retained for the entire period that the subject property is eligible and receives Class 9 designation. Said certifications will be made available to members of the Cook County Assessor's Office for inspection and review.
  4. I attest that these rents do not exceed the maximum rents allowable for the area in which the residential real property is located.
  5. If applicable, attached is documentation verifying Section 8 Housing Assistance for those Section 8 units which qualify as Class 9 units during the year in question.
  6. Rents for at least thirty-five percent (35%) of the units at the subject property have not, and will not exceed the applicable Class 9 Affordable Rents for the calendar year in question. (See Class 9 Rent and Tenant Income Schedule here.) Or rents for at least thirty-five percent (35%) of the units at the subject property are for units occupied by households receiving housing assistance under Section 8 of the United States Housing Act of 1937 as amended.
  7. Total household income for all Class 9 units at the subject property has not, and will not exceed the applicable Class 9 maximum income levels for the calendar year in question. (See Class 9 Rent and Tenant Income Schedule here.)
  8. During the calendar year in question, I delivered or mailed written notice of the current permissible Class 9 affordable rental levels and income levels to those tenants occupying the Class 9 affordable rents.
